The potential of gibberellic acid 3 (GA3) and Tween-80 induced phytoremediation of co-contamination of Cd and Benzo[a]pyrene (B[a]P) using Tagetes patula
چکیده انگلیسی

The present study was conducted to investigate the effectiveness of GA3 and Tween-80 on enhancing the phytoremediation of Cd–B[a]P co-contaminated soils. Results showed that the addition of GA3 and GA3–Tween-80 enhanced Tagetes patula growth by 14%–32% and 23%–55%, respectively, relative to the control group. However, under independent GA3-treated soils, Cd and B[a]P concentrations in the shoots of the plants decreased by 15%–33% and 15%–53%, respectively, compared with CK. By contrast, the shoot concentration and accumulation of Cd under GA3–Tween-80 treatment increased by 0.01–0.46 and 1.33–1.55 times, respectively, whereas those of B[a]P increased from 0.57 to 0.82, and 1.33 to 1.55 times, respectively, compared with those of the control. Optimal result for Cd phytoextraction was obtained under combined 5 mmol Tween-80 kg−1 and 1 mmol GA3 kg−1 treatment, and the maximum removal rate of B[a]P was obtained after the application of 5 mmol Tween-80 kg−1 and 5 mmol GA3 kg−1.


► Phytoremediation is a cost-effective, environment-friendly and sustainable method.
► Tagetes patula has been validated as a Cd hyperaccumulator recently.
► It's feasible to clean Cd–B[a]P contaminated soils using GA3 and Tween-80.
